Interacting With Application Beneath Transparent Layer
US-2017017385-A1 · Jan 19, 2017 · US
US10438080B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-10438080-B2 |
| Application number | US-201615550974-A |
| Country | US |
| Kind code | B2 |
| Filing date | Feb 11, 2016 |
| Priority date | Feb 12, 2015 |
| Publication date | Oct 8, 2019 |
| Grant date | Oct 8, 2019 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
A method of generating handwriting information about handwriting of a user includes determining a first writing focus and a second writing focus; sequentially shooting a first local writing area, which is within a predetermined range from a first writing focus, and a second local writing area, which is within a predetermined range from a second writing focus; obtaining first handwriting from the first local writing area and second handwriting from the second local writing area; combining the first handwriting with the second handwriting; and generating the handwriting information, based on a result of the combining.
Opening claim text (preview).
The invention claimed is: 1. An apparatus for providing handwriting information about handwriting of a user, the apparatus comprising: a camera; and at least one processor configured to: obtain a user input, obtain sequentially, using the camera, a first local writing area which is within a predetermined range from a first writing focus, and a second local writing area which is within a predetermined range from a second writing focus, identify the first writing focus and the second writing focus, obtain first handwriting from the first local writing area, obtain second handwriting from the second local writing area, combine the first handwriting with the second handwriting, and provide handwriting information, based on a result of the combining. 2. The apparatus of claim 1 , wherein the processor is further configured to: trace a visual focus of the user, and identify the first writing focus and the second writing focus, based on the traced visual focus. 3. The apparatus of claim 1 , wherein the processor is further configured to: obtain information about a color of handwriting from the user, and obtain the first handwriting from the first local writing area and the second handwriting from the second local writing area, based on information about the color of the handwriting. 4. The apparatus of claim 1 , wherein the processor is further configured to: compare the first handwriting with the second handwriting, identify changed handwriting between a captured image frame of the first local writing area and a captured image frame of the second local writing area, based on a result of the comparing, and combine the changed handwriting, based on a result of the determining. 5. The apparatus of claim 4 , wherein the processor is further configured to: determine whether a pause signal is detected, stop the handwriting obtaining and the handwriting combining, based on a result of the determining, and perform monitoring. 6. The apparatus of claim 5 , wherein the processor is further configured to: determine whether a pause signal is received, based on whether the changed handwriting between the captured image frame of the first local writing area and the captured image frame of the second local writing area or the tip of the writing tool is detected, whether a changing angle of the head posture of the user exceeds a predetermined value, whether a distance between the visual focus of the user and the writing focus exceeds a predetermined value, and whether a pause instruction was received. 7. The apparatus of claim 1 , wherein the handwriting information comprises at least one of time sequence information of local handwriting and layout information, the handwriting information is stored in at least one format from among a document format, an image format, and a video format, and the layout information comprises line break information and identifier information of at least one of a deleting identifier, a replacement identifier, a repeat characteristic identifier, an insertion identifier, a position adjusting identifier, and an emphasis identifier. 8. The apparatus of claim 1 , wherein the processor is further configured to: obtain audio data generated while the first local writing area and the second local writing area are being sequentially obtained, and provide the handwriting information such that the obtained audio data corresponds to the first handwriting and the second handwriting. 9. The apparatus of claim 8 , wherein the processor is further configured to: provide the handwriting information such that audio data received between a shooting time of the first local area and a shooting time of the second local area corresponds to changed handwriting between a captured image frame of the first local writing area and a captured image frame of the second local writing area. 10. The apparatus of claim 1 , wherein the processor is further configured to: apply an enhancement process to the obtained first handwriting and the obtained second handwriting, the enhancement process is applicable when light brightness or definition during shooting does not meet a pre-defined requirement, when a thickness of the obtained first or second handwriting is smaller than a pre-defined value, or when a difference between a color of handwriting in a captured image and a background color is smaller than a predefined value, and the enhancement process removes a stroke whose confidence evaluation value is lower than a threshold from among at least one stroke included in the first handwriting and the second handwriting. 11. A method of providing handwriting information about handwriting of a user, the method comprising: identifying, by at least one processor of an apparatus, a first writing focus and a second writing focus; obtaining sequentially, by the at least one processor, by using a camera of the apparatus, a first local writing area which is within a predetermined range from a first writing focus, and a second local writing area which is within a predetermined range from a second writing focus; obtaining, by the at least one processor, first handwriting from the first local writing area and second handwriting from the second local writing area; combining, by the at least one processor, the first handwriting with the second handwriting; and providing, by the at least one processor, the handwriting information, based on a result of the combining. 12. The method of claim 11 , wherein identifying the first writing focus and the second writing focus comprises: tracing a tip of a writing tool; identifying a position of the tip of the writing tool; and identifying the first writing focus and the second writing focus, based on the identified position of the tip of the writing tool. 13. The method of claim 11 , wherein obtaining the first handwriting from the first local writing area and the second handwriting from the second local writing area comprises obtaining the first handwriting from the first local writing area and the second handwriting from the second local writing area, based on a difference between a handwriting color and a color of a writing background. 14. The method of claim 11 , further comprising: determining whether an ending signal is detected; and ending the handwriting obtaining, the handwriting combining, and the providing of the handwriting information, based on a result of the determining. 15. A computer program product comprising a non-transitory computer readable storage medium comprising instructions to cause a computing device to perform a method of providing handwriting information about handwriting of a user, the method comprising: identifying a first writing focus and a second writing focus; obtaining sequentially a first local writing area which is within a predetermined range from a first writing focus, and a second local writing area which is within a predetermined range from a second writing focus; obtaining first handwriting from the first local writing area and second handwriting from the second local writing area; combining the first handwriting with the second handwriting; and providing the handwriting information, based on a result of the combining. 16. The method of claim 15 , wherein obtaining the first handwriting from the first local writing area and the second handwriting from the second local writing area comprises obtaining the first handwriting from the first local writing area and the second handwriting from the second local writing area, based on a difference between a handwriting color and a color of a writing backg
the instrument generating sequences of position coordinates corresponding to handwriting (preprocessing or recognising digital ink G06V30/32) · CPC title
Arrangements for interaction with the human body, e.g. for user immersion in virtual reality (blind teaching G09B21/00) · CPC title
based on user input or interaction · CPC title
Audio in a user interface, e.g. using voice commands for navigating, audio feedback · CPC title
Head tracking input arrangements ·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.